Pro-Wrestling: EVE has announced a training camp for female wrestlers in the UK on February 19th and 20th. The camp will be lead by Ricky and Saraya Knight.

Full details below:

Europe’s only dedicated all female professional wrestling promotion
Pro-Wrestling:EVE presents a FEMALE ONLY professional wrestling training
camp to take place on the weekend of February 19/20 in Norwich, England.

The camp will be taken by legendary professional wrestling promotion WAW
lead by 26 year veteran “Rowdy” Ricky Knight and his wife & 19 year
Professional Saraya Knight.

“Rowdy” Ricky Knight has wrestled all over the world both with and against
some of the biggest & best stars to ever grace a wrestling ring from
Dynamite Kid & Jushin “Thunder” Liger to Giant Haystacks & Finlay and
everyone in between – The Rowdy Man has nothing left to prove to anyone
and is a fountain of knowledge that every aspiring wrestler be they male
or female should desire to train with.

NXT Season 3 winner Kaitlyn is finally emerging in the “big time” SmackDown, so it’s fitting that this week she’s premiered her first official photoshoot as a Diva. It may look familiar to you (actually it should look familiar), since photos from the studio portion of the shoot were released at the beginning of her NXT run. However, there’s still enough new stuff to unwrap..

The Look: Okay, so this outfit is nothing new–it dates back to the NXT rookies’ first photoshoots, so your reaction’s down to whether you liked it or not way back then. In terms of wrestling gear, I like it–it’s tough, with its black leather top and boots, but it’s cut the right way to fulfill the sexiness quota it seems like every Diva’s gear has to reach. Not to mention, it highlights her two most flattering features: her sculpted arms and legs. This gives Kaitlyn her own signature look, with the top and shorts being the base of it. I like this shoot’s version a lot more than some of her other variations of the look–I wasn’t a fan of the denim and cheetah print one. The black and dark camouflage print looks a lot sleeker, and I have to say the camo shorts are a lot more flattering than those skin-tight, ovary-crushing denim shorts.

The Poses: Kaitlyn exudes a calm, confident manner throughout the entire shoot, her poses relaxed. I like it, as it feels real and not as put-on as the more smiley, happy poses other Divas may utilize. Her poses next to the steel beam are particularly interesting. While these poses aren’t all that different from the ones from her other shoots, you have to consider that they were all probably taken around the same time, when she wasn’t exactly in the flow of WWE photoshoots yet. Even so, I really like the feel of this photoshoot.

If you listen to Diva Dirt LIVE, you know that I get fired almost every week.  I really do try my best but inevitably I screw something up – either by calling someone the wrong name, or messing up the switchboard, or making some lame joke that not even my co-hosts will sell.  Whatever the reason I always find myself on shaky ground, which stinks because I really do love hosting the show.  Interacting with the callers and special guests is a lot of fun and if I can learn something about the “Real Housewives of Beverly Hills” along the way, all the better!  Fortunately for me Melanie usually has a change of heart during the week and lets me keep my job, so basically I’m working on a series of 1-week contracts (although what Melanie doesn’t know is that I’m kind of like a stray cat…feed me once and I’m hard to get rid of.)  So I never know how long this gig will last, but Diva Dirt LIVE has been on the air since June 2010 and I’m extremely proud of that.

Now, if there ever WAS a reason for Melanie to fire me it was during this past Royal Rumble in Boston (and no, I’m not talking about the plaid shirt I wore.)  I admit, I dropped the ball…big time.  See the WWE sold t-shirts at the event that advertised the Divas Championship as a fatal 4-way match, which is fine except no one was supposed to know that before the “anonymous general manager” changed the match at the last minute.  As Natalya was all set to defend her Divas title vs. Lay-Cool in a handicap match, Michael Cole received an email essentially adding a fourth competitor.

Of course I would have already known that had I just read the back of my son’s t-shirt.  UGH!

Diva Dirt reader Billy James sent in his live report and pictures from TNA’s house show in Pensacola, FL this past Saturday. The event saw a rare house show appearance from Sarita facing Angelina Love.

Before the show started, I was to get both Angelina and Sarita’s autographs. Both ladies were very nice especially Sarita as I had the chance to briefly talk to my second favorite Knockout. I told her that loved her matches with Mickie James as they have great chemistry together and I hope that she feuds with Mickie over the Knockouts Title. Sarita that she hopes so too as she wants a run with the belt. I also had the chance to tell her about the nickname that I and some of my wrestling friends have for her, “The Salsa Mama” which she liked. Angelina got the win over Sarita with Botox Injection. I had an eraser board with me on which I wrote: “Sarita: The Salsa Mama” when Sarita came out for the match. Let me say that Sarita is just as good live as she is on TV. I found out after the show that it’s rare for Sarita to do TNA house shows due to her obligations with Consejo Mundial de Lucha Libre (CMLL) in Mexico.

Next year’s WrestleMania, the 28th edition, will air live from Miami, FL on April 1st, 2012.

Divas Champion, Eve Torres was on hand for a press conference today in Miami.

The news is notable because it had previously been reported that Toronto was being considered as a possible location, leading to rumor that Trish Stratus may be in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ame next year as it’s her hometown. Obviously, today’s announcement would quash that. It could happen, but seems unlikely.

SHIMMER – WOMEN ATHLETES is proud to announce the addition of three more of the SHIMMER originals to next month’s tapings! Nikki Roxx, Ariel, and Allison Danger will be a part of the SHIMMER Volumes 37-40 tapings, which will take place on Saturday & Sunday, March 26th & 27th, 2011 at the Berwyn Eagles Club (6309 26th Street) in Berwyn, IL, just outside Chicago! Visit http://www.shimmerwrestling.com/ to order your tickets if you haven’t already.

In 2005, eighteen women gathered in Berwyn, IL to, in their own small way, try to make a positive change in the how women’s professional wrestling is viewed in North America. With the addition of Nikki, Ariel, and Allison to the March events, we are happy to have eight of those original SHIMMER eighteen participating in Volumes 37-40, five and a half years later.

NXT three winner, Kaitlyn summoned her inner bad girl over the weekend by teaming up with one half of Lay-Cool, Layla against the team of Beth Phoenix and Natalya.

Results from the two shows:

Saturday: 2. “The Glamazon” Beth Phoenix and Natalya Neidhart defeated Layla El and Kaitlyn. Although not glaringly awful, this match went too long. The crowd was big into the faces, though, and Beth’s face-in-peril act for most of the match really got the crowd going. Finish saw a double pin with Beth hitting a Glam Slam on Kaitlyn and Nattie (legal woman) hitting a Michinokou Driver on Layla for the win. (Source)

Sunday: 2. Natalya and Beth Phoenix beat Layla and Kaitlyn. They won via body slam and Glam Slam for a double pin. The faces got a good reaction and the match was long. (Source)

Thoughts: As we always say with these types of things, house show results don’t necessarily mean a heel turn. Still, I’d be curious to see how Kaitlyn works as a heel. YouTube footage, anyone?
